ESPN will televise the 28-hour Draft Kings Fantasy Football Marathon in preparation for the 2016 NFL season on Aug. 15-16. The first-time programming initiative - starting Monday, Aug. 15 at 7 p.m. ET through Tuesday, Aug. 16 at 11 p.m. - will feature Fantasy Football specials in primetime both nights, segments on multiple editions of SportsCenter, and Fantasy Football-themed editions of popular ESPN shows, including First Take, Mike & Mike, His & Hers, SPORTSNATION and NFL Live. All programs during the marathon will be streamed live on WatchESPN.

Senior Fantasy Sports Analyst Matthew Berry and NFL Insider Adam Schefter will appear on ESPN shows throughout the entire 28 hours. Michelle Beadle and Trey Wingo will co-host the primetime shows on both nights - the five-hour SPORTSCENTER Special: Fantasy Football Rankings (Aug. 15: 7 p.m. ET, ESPN2) and the marathon-ending four-hour SPORTSCENTER Special: Fantasy Football Celebrity Mock Draft (Aug. 16: 7 p.m., ESPN), which will include a live Fantasy Football draft with ESPN commentators and celebrities. Kenny Mayne will also be part of the primetime shows and other programs, sharing his football insights and his unique humor and wit.

ESPN Fantasy Football, the industry's No. 1 fantasy game, returns for its 21st season this fall with new content and features across ESPN platforms. The game is free for all fans and is accompanied by the most comprehensive collection of expert analysis, news, tools and statistical information in fantasy sports, including industry's top Fantasy Football mobile App.

"Fantasy Football is so enormously popular and with fans everywhere now joining leagues and drafting teams we will officially kick off the new season across ESPN platforms with this 28-hour marathon," said Norby Williamson, ESPN Executive Vice President, Production. "This is among our most creative and collaborative ideas to date. We will utilize resources across our many television and radio shows, ESPN Stats & Information, ESPN Fantasy Sports, ESPN Social and more, while showcasing the ESPN Fantasy App, to make this a big, fun event for fans."

Special guests and celebrities expected to participate in the Fantasy Football draft in primetime on Aug. 16 include: Mike Greenberg and Mike Golic of Mike & Mike; Michael Smith and Jemele Hill of His & Hers; former NFL wide receivers Terrell Owens and Chad Johnson; comedian Frank Caliendo; popular music artist Darius Rucker; FOOD NETWORK STAR and celebrity chef Bobby Flay; and actress Jamie Lynn-Sigler (The Sopranos and Entourage).
